## Artifact Signing

All tracing-service builds at Quillbend are signed before promotion. The trace-collector, span-router, and context-propagator images share one signing identity per release train, so request IDs stay verifiable end to end across services. New team members: never promote an unsigned image; the registry rejects them anyway. Verification runs automatically in the Harrowgate cluster. The current release signing key is shown below.

deploy key for kajof-fajop: bky6_gDHw9Q

Postmortem timeline — Givewell-style receipt mailer outage (internal project Lanternbox). 14:02 — batch job started with stale template cache. 14:09 — first reports of receipts showing last quarter's donation totals. 14:15 — mailer paused by on-call. 14:31 — cache flushed, job restarted cleanly. 14:55 — 312 corrected receipts re-sent. Root cause: template cache not invalidated on deploy. For context when reviewing logs, the affected deploy is identified by the trace token below.

pipeline stamp: htk9_ce63042d9

**TICKET-2087: Expired key — Siftgate bloom filter layer**

The bloom filter fronting the Pebblestore key-value cluster stopped refreshing its membership set at 03:10 because its service credentials expired. Lookups still work but false-negative rates are climbing. Rotate the config on both filter nodes. The replacement key for the Pebblestore service is below.

API key for yahig-tadup: kto7_ubizbYm

**Step 7 — Migration gate sign-off.** Before the ceremony proceeds, confirm the Larkfield schema migration has completed its dual-write phase with zero downtime: both old and new columns must show matching row counts, and the backfill job must report done. Only then may the key custodian unseal the signing module, which prompts for the recovery passphrase below.

recovery phrase for fajep-yaweg: gilath-sorox-wenius-rusdor-keliel-zorius